[CardManager/f21] Added appdata.xml
jiri vanek
jvanek at fedoraproject.org
Mon Jul 28 10:28:28 UTC 2014
commit 4e7e8944da72bb5d423f7312f9d4464c3141ce04
Author: Jiri <jvanek at redhat.com>
Date: Mon Jul 28 12:27:38 2014 +0200
Added appdata.xml
CardManager.appdata.xml | 35 +++++++++++++++++++++++++++++++++++
CardManager.spec | 10 +++++++---
2 files changed, 42 insertions(+), 3 deletions(-)
---
diff --git a/CardManager.appdata.xml b/CardManager.appdata.xml
new file mode 100644
index 0000000..9462704
--- /dev/null
+++ b/CardManager.appdata.xml
@@ -0,0 +1,35 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!-- Copyright 2014 Jiri Vanek <judovana at email.cz> -->
+<application>
+ <id type="desktop">CardManager.desktop</id>
+ <metadata_license>CC0</metadata_license>
+ <description>
+ <p>
+ This is free, open source multiplatform (java) application which allows you to
+ play ANY card game.
+ </p>
+ <p>
+ The game is designed especially to play collectible card games like Magic the
+ Gathering or Doomtrooper over network.
+ </p>
+ <p>
+ To play those games you need to own (scanned) images of card, which are not part
+ of this package.
+ </p>
+ <p>
+ Some can be easily downloadable from internet, but be aware of copyrights.
+ The default deck and background is free of copyright
+ Also please feel free to add your own backgrounds to
+ ~/CardManager/data/backgrounds and of course enhance
+ collection under ~/CardManager/collection .
+ </p>
+ </description>
+ <screenshots>
+ <screenshot type="default" width="1906" height="1066">http://cardmanager.wz.cz/Screenshot.png</screenshot>
+ <screenshot width="1666" height="955">http://cardmanager.wz.cz/Screenshot-4.png</screenshot>
+ <screenshot width="3600" height="1080">http://cardmanager.wz.cz/Screenshot-3.png</screenshot>
+ </screenshots>
+ <url type="homepage">http://cardmanager.wz.cz/</url>
+ <updatecontact>judovana_at_email.cz</updatecontact>
+</application>
+
diff --git a/CardManager.spec b/CardManager.spec
index 5cb727f..200ce63 100644
--- a/CardManager.spec
+++ b/CardManager.spec
@@ -1,12 +1,13 @@
Name: CardManager
Version: 3
-Release: 4%{?dist}
+Release: 5%{?dist}
Summary: Java application to allows you to play any, especially collectible, card game
Group: Amusements/Games
License: BSD
URL: http://cardmanager.wz.cz/
Source0: http://cardmanager.wz.cz/CardManager_sources%{version}.zip
+Source1: %{name}.appdata.xml
Patch0: removeManifestEntries.patch
BuildArch: noarch
@@ -63,6 +64,8 @@ cp -p ./FedoraLauncher.sh $RPM_BUILD_ROOT%{_bindir}/CardManager
#end launcher
+#appdata
+install -Dpm0644 %{SOURCE1} %{buildroot}%{_datadir}/appdata/%{name}.appdata.xml
mkdir -p $RPM_BUILD_ROOT%{_javadir}
cp -p dist/%{name}.jar $RPM_BUILD_ROOT%{_javadir}/%{name}.jar
@@ -80,6 +83,7 @@ cp -r dist/javadoc/* $RPM_BUILD_ROOT%{_javadocdir}/%{name}
%attr(755,root,root) %{_bindir}/CardManager
%{_javadir}/*
%doc license.txt
+%{_datadir}/appdata/%{name}.appdata.xml
%files javadoc
%{_javadocdir}/%{name}
@@ -87,8 +91,8 @@ cp -r dist/javadoc/* $RPM_BUILD_ROOT%{_javadocdir}/%{name}
%changelog
-* Fri Jun 06 2014 Fedora Release Engineering <rel-eng at lists.fedoraproject.org> - 3-4
-- Rebuilt for https://fedoraproject.org/wiki/Fedora_21_Mass_Rebuild
+* Mon Jul 28 2014 Jiri Vanek <jvanek at redhat.com> - 3-5
+- Added appdata.xml
* Thu Aug 08 2013 Mat Booth <fedora at matbooth.co.uk> - 3-3
- Drop BR on ant-nodeps, fixes rhbz #991930
More information about the scm-commits
mailing list